描述

Edward de Bono's work offers a fresh approach to thinking and problem-solving, particularly suited for those who thrive in action-oriented environments. He presents an intriguing framework that employs a metaphorical set of six hats, each representing different perspectives and strategies. This innovative concept encourages readers to explore issues from multiple angles, fostering a deeper understanding and more effective decision-making.

The book emphasizes the importance of systematic thinking, guiding individuals to consider emotional, creative, analytical, and strategic viewpoints. By employing the six hats, readers are equipped to enhance their collaborative efforts and unleash creative potential in both personal and professional contexts. De Bono's approach is not only practical but also adaptable, making it relevant for various situations ranging from corporate decision-making to everyday life challenges.

Throughout the narrative, real-world applications and examples illustrate the significance of using diverse thinking methods. Readers are inspired to break free from conventional thought patterns and cultivate a more dynamic mindset. This examination of thought itself is a vital resource for leaders, teams, and anyone seeking to enhance their cognitive toolkit.

Ultimately, de Bono's guide serves as an empowering invitation to approach problems with curiosity and clarity, encouraging a culture of constructive dialogue and innovative solutions. It’s an essential read for individuals ready to engage with challenges in a transformative way.
